Mukuru helps you move money around Africa. Whether you are sending cash for instant collection or topping up a bank account or mobile wallet it has never been easier. We use the latest mobile and web-based technologies to give you the best experience possible. But that’s just half the story. To really understand us, you need to know the "why” behind all ...
Read more about this company
As a IntermediateSoftware Engineer (PHP), you’ll be at the heart of it all: designing, building, and scaling applications that directly impact how people send and receive money. You’ll join a collaborative, forward-thinking team that values innovation, continuous learning, and real-world impact.
What You’ll Do
Design & Build: Develop and maintain PHP applications and microservices.
APIs That Matter: Design and integrate RESTful APIs with new and existing systems.
Data Mastery: Work with MySQL databases, optimising schemas and queries.
Collaborate: Work hand-in-hand with cross-functional teams to deliver impactful features.
Raise the Bar: Participate in code reviews, testing, and debugging to deliver high-quality solutions.
Innovate: Apply industry best practices, SOLID principles, and modern design patterns.
Stay Ahead: Keep pace with emerging tools, cloud technologies, and development trends.
What You’ll Bring
Grade 12 or equivalent (Essential).
IT degree or diploma (Desirable).
5+ years’ experience as a software engineer.
Strong background in PHP frameworks and open-source technologies.
Solid experience with Docker, CI/CD pipelines, and modern Git workflows.
Hands-on expertise in database management (migration, scripting, optimisation).
Knowledge of microservices, RESTful APIs, and cloud technologies (AWS, etc.).
Agile mindset with experience in Scrum or Kanban environments.
Bonus Skills
Excellent communication and collaboration skills.
Ability to thrive both independently and as part of a team.
Passion for continuous learning and staying up to date with new tech.